Where does “जनप्रतिनिधित्व” come from?

जनप्रतिनिधित्व (Hindi) comes from Hindi जनप्रतिनिधि, from Hindi जन, from Sanskrit जन, from Proto-Indo-Aryan ȷ́ánHas, from Proto-Indo-Iranian ȷ́ánHas, from Proto-Indo-European ǵónh₁os, from Proto-Indo-European ǵenh₁- — to produce, to beget, to give birth.

जनप्रतिनिधित्व (Hindi): elected representation

Definitions

  1. elected representation
